Have you considered building your own? We build our own cases all the time both for long barreled guns and the large optics we use.
A piece of 1x6 for the sides and 1/4"or 3/8" plywood for the top and bottom works for guns.
Make the frame from the 1x6 in the size youwant and install the plywood. Then run it thru a table saw to separate the lid from the bottom.
You can find foam rubber on line and it cuts easily with an electric knife.
Verticle gun boxes also work well with no foam being necessary. Just padded cradles to support the gun.
Ours take lots of abuse being shoved into pickup beds and jeeps with all kind of things piled on top of them and then bounced around on dirt roads
for several weeks.
